Why single-core shielded cable is becoming a strategic system component as electrification, EMC rigor, and uptime expectations intensify

Single-core shielded cable sits at the intersection of reliability, electromagnetic compatibility, and rising system complexity. As industrial assets become more sensor-dense, as vehicles adopt higher-voltage architectures, and as energy infrastructure modernizes, the role of a well-designed shielded conductor shifts from a component choice to a system-level risk decision. Designers depend on shielding to suppress electromagnetic interference, protect signal integrity, and help equipment meet regulatory requirements without excessive redesign. At the same time, procurement teams face an increasingly nuanced value equation: material selection, termination quality, installation method, and certification path all influence total installed cost and field performance.

In practical deployments, the cable is rarely evaluated in isolation. It must perform across mechanical stress, thermal cycling, chemicals, vibration, and routing constraints while maintaining shielding effectiveness through bends, connectors, glands, and grounding strategies. That is why buyers increasingly prioritize not only electrical properties but also construction details such as braid coverage, foil overlap, drain wire configuration, jacket compound selection, and compatibility with industrial connector ecosystems.

As the market expands into more demanding environments, expectations are also rising around documentation, traceability, and lifecycle support. End users want predictable lead times, consistent quality, and application guidance that prevents preventable failures such as shield discontinuities, improper bonding, or galvanic corrosion at terminations. Consequently, the competitive landscape is evolving toward suppliers that can combine engineering support with robust manufacturing discipline and compliance readiness.

From commodity to engineered assurance: the new forces reshaping demand through electrification, EMC-by-design, and resilient sourcing priorities

The landscape is experiencing a shift from “cable as commodity” toward “cable as engineered assurance.” One transformative change is the tightening relationship between EMC performance and functional safety. In sectors such as factory automation, rail, medical equipment, and high-voltage mobility platforms, interference is no longer viewed as a nuisance that can be filtered later; it is treated as a root-cause risk that can degrade control stability, measurement accuracy, and communication reliability. This is pushing engineering teams to specify shielding performance alongside dielectric strength, temperature rating, and mechanical robustness from the earliest design stages.

A second shift is driven by electrification and power density. As inverters, fast-switching power electronics, and higher currents proliferate, radiated and conducted emissions become more challenging to manage. Single-core shielded constructions are increasingly used not just for sensitive signal lines but also in power and hybrid power/control paths where noise suppression, grounding strategy, and thermal behavior must be balanced. This is accelerating innovation in shield materials and coverage strategies, along with jacket compounds that can withstand higher continuous temperatures and harsher exposure.

Manufacturing and qualification models are also changing. Customers increasingly expect documented compliance to relevant standards, repeatable process controls, and faster qualification cycles. That need is amplified by the rise of platform-based product development in automotive and industrial equipment, where a validated cable family is reused across multiple models. Suppliers that can provide stable formulations, consistent braid quality, and disciplined change control are gaining preference, particularly where requalification costs are high.

Finally, supply-chain resilience has moved from a procurement concern to a board-level theme. Copper price volatility, specialty polymer availability, and geopolitical constraints have encouraged multi-sourcing, regionalization of production, and closer scrutiny of where shielding materials and compounds originate. As a result, purchasing decisions increasingly reflect risk-adjusted cost rather than unit price alone, elevating the value of dependable lead times, flexible manufacturing footprints, and transparent documentation.

How United States tariffs in 2025 reshape landed cost, sourcing architecture, and qualification strategies for single-core shielded cable buyers

The 2025 tariff environment in the United States is expected to influence single-core shielded cable decisions through both direct cost effects and indirect supply-chain behavior. Because these cables rely on globally traded inputs-copper, aluminum in some constructions, specialty polymers, and shielding materials-tariffs can affect not only finished cable imports but also upstream components and subassemblies. When duties touch intermediate goods, even domestically assembled products can see cost pressure, which then cascades into pricing, inventory strategies, and contracting practices.

One cumulative impact is a renewed emphasis on country-of-origin transparency and documentation readiness. Buyers that serve regulated industries or government-adjacent infrastructure often need clear provenance records, while manufacturers need the ability to certify origin without slowing shipments. This dynamic favors suppliers with mature trade compliance processes, well-structured bills of materials, and the operational discipline to manage product variants across different sourcing scenarios.

Another impact is accelerated dual-sourcing and nearshoring behavior. Rather than shifting all volume to one alternative geography, many buyers are splitting awards across multiple qualified suppliers to reduce tariff exposure and prevent single-point disruptions. This has implications for engineering teams, who may need to harmonize specifications so that equivalent constructions from different factories remain interchangeable. In turn, suppliers are investing in qualification support, cross-plant process alignment, and tighter tolerance control to meet interchangeability expectations.

Tariffs also tend to change negotiation levers. Contracts increasingly incorporate adjustment clauses tied to metal indices, resin surcharges, or duty-related triggers. While such clauses can reduce disputes, they also require stronger forecasting of demand and clearer communication between procurement, engineering, and finance. Companies that treat tariff risk as a structural feature-rather than a temporary shock-are more likely to maintain margin discipline while protecting customer relationships.

Over time, these pressures can reshape the competitive set in the U.S. market. Suppliers with domestic or tariff-advantaged production options may gain share in time-sensitive projects, while import-reliant sellers may pivot toward niches where specialized performance outweighs cost changes. The practical takeaway is that tariff exposure is becoming part of technical selection, particularly when delivery reliability and compliance evidence are valued as highly as electrical performance.

Segmentation signals that application environment, shielding architecture, and installation realities now dictate purchasing more than generic cable categories

Across the market, segmentation patterns reveal that use-case specificity is becoming the dominant driver of product selection. Demand behavior differs sharply depending on whether the application is oriented toward industrial controls, instrumentation, energy systems, transportation platforms, or building infrastructure, and those differences show up in shielding expectations, jacket choices, and installation practices. In environments with dense automation and high switching noise, users tend to emphasize consistent shielding effectiveness, predictable termination behavior, and compatibility with connectors and glands that preserve the shield path.

Material-driven segmentation remains central, particularly where temperature, chemical exposure, and flexibility constraints collide. Some buyers prioritize high-flex constructions and robust jackets for continuous motion, while others focus on thermal endurance near power electronics or in confined enclosures. Shield design choices-such as foil-only, braid-only, or combined foil-and-braid-often mirror the interference profile and mechanical wear conditions. Where abrasion, vibration, and repeated handling are common, braid-centric approaches tend to be favored; where high-frequency noise suppression and coverage uniformity dominate, foil-based strategies can be attractive, often with a drain wire to simplify grounding.

Voltage class and conductor construction also separate decision pathways. As electrification increases, requirements around insulation robustness, partial discharge resistance in higher-stress contexts, and stable performance across thermal cycling receive more attention. At the same time, stranded versus solid conductor choices influence flexibility, termination consistency, and long-run installation outcomes. Buyers managing complex harnessing or routing through tight geometries tend to adopt stranded constructions, while fixed installations may optimize around solid conductors for stability and sometimes cost.

Installation environment further differentiates purchasing criteria. Indoor control cabinets, outdoor infrastructure, underground conduits, and high-EMI industrial zones each impose distinct needs for flame behavior, UV resistance, oil resistance, and ingress protection compatibility. This is pushing suppliers to articulate clearer application guidance rather than relying on broad claims of “industrial-grade” performance.

Finally, end-user procurement models shape segmentation outcomes. OEMs often seek platform consistency, documentation, and long-term supply assurance, while contractors and integrators may prioritize availability, ease of installation, and local support. This split encourages product portfolios that pair standardized, high-runner constructions with engineered-to-order variants for specialized environments and compliance regimes.

Regional demand patterns diverge on compliance, industrial intensity, and sourcing risk, shaping how shielded cables are specified worldwide

Regional dynamics reflect different industrial structures, regulatory contexts, and investment cycles, which collectively shape how single-core shielded cable is specified and purchased. In the Americas, electrification projects, grid modernization, and ongoing automation investment keep demand anchored in performance and delivery reliability. The United States market, in particular, is sensitive to trade policy shifts and qualification expectations, encouraging regional manufacturing options, inventory buffering, and closer supplier collaboration on documentation.

Across Europe, the Middle East, and Africa, compliance culture and cross-border standardization tend to elevate the importance of tested performance, traceability, and sustainability considerations. Industrial automation intensity in parts of Europe supports sophisticated EMC requirements, while energy transition investments-ranging from renewables integration to electrified transport-create sustained pull for cables that can operate reliably under thermal and mechanical stress. In the Middle East, infrastructure development and industrial expansion can emphasize ruggedized constructions and project-driven procurement cycles, whereas some African markets prioritize availability and durability under challenging environmental conditions.

In Asia-Pacific, manufacturing scale and rapid electrification are key demand engines. High-density electronics production, expanding automation, and continued buildout of transportation and energy assets support broad adoption of shielded solutions. Buyers in the region often balance high performance requirements with cost competitiveness, which can favor suppliers that combine scale manufacturing with consistent quality systems. Additionally, regional supply networks can shorten lead times, although qualification requirements for export-oriented products still demand robust compliance documentation.

Across all regions, a common theme is the growing importance of local technical support and faster response times. As EMC issues can be costly to troubleshoot after installation, end users increasingly prefer suppliers or distributors that can advise on grounding schemes, routing best practices, and termination integrity, ensuring shielding performance is preserved from design through commissioning.

Competition favors suppliers that combine engineered portfolios, repeatable shielding quality, and ecosystem-level support from design through installation

Company strategies in single-core shielded cable increasingly revolve around three differentiators: engineering credibility, manufacturing consistency, and ecosystem integration. Leading suppliers compete by offering broad portfolios that span shield types, insulation and jacket compounds, temperature classes, and compliance options, allowing buyers to standardize while still fitting varied environments. Just as important, they provide application engineering support that helps customers select constructions aligned with real interference profiles and grounding constraints rather than relying on over-specified designs.

Manufacturing discipline has become a frontline competitive advantage. Customers are scrutinizing braid coverage repeatability, concentricity, insulation thickness control, and jacket integrity because small variations can translate into field failures or compliance challenges. As a result, suppliers highlight process control, in-line testing, and traceability practices, and they invest in capacity that can sustain stable lead times even when demand spikes.

Go-to-market approaches are also evolving. Some companies deepen partnerships with OEMs by aligning roadmaps and supporting platform qualification, while others focus on distribution-led availability for integrators and maintenance channels. In both cases, documentation packages-certifications, material declarations, and test reports-are increasingly part of the “product” customers expect to receive.

Mergers, acquisitions, and portfolio rationalization continue to influence competitive positioning as firms seek scale, regional footprint, and complementary product families. However, buyers remain cautious: they want continuity of specifications and change-control rigor after any consolidation. Companies that communicate clearly about manufacturing changes, maintain backward compatibility where possible, and support requalification needs are better positioned to retain long-standing accounts.

Overall, competitive success is trending toward suppliers that treat the cable as an engineered subsystem within a larger connectivity solution, offering not only wire and shield but also the guidance to ensure terminations, grounding, and installation practices deliver the intended EMC performance.

Decisive moves for leaders: reduce EMC risk, harden supply against trade shocks, and win on lifecycle reliability not unit price alone

Industry leaders can strengthen position by aligning product and sourcing strategies with real-world EMC and electrification requirements. First, treat shielding performance as a system outcome rather than a catalog attribute. Standardize internal guidance on grounding and termination practices, validate performance in representative installation conditions, and ensure that connector and gland choices preserve shield continuity. This reduces costly troubleshooting and helps teams specify fit-for-purpose constructions instead of defaulting to the most expensive option.

Second, build tariff and trade resilience into procurement playbooks. Qualify at least one alternate source with comparable constructions and documented interchangeability, and consider regionally balanced supply where lead times and compliance needs justify it. Contract structures should anticipate metal and polymer volatility with transparent adjustment mechanisms that limit surprises while preserving supplier stability.

Third, invest in materials and design choices that reduce lifecycle risk. For harsh environments, prioritize jacket compounds and shield constructions proven against abrasion, oils, UV exposure, and flexing where applicable. For high-noise electrified systems, emphasize robust insulation and shielding strategies that maintain effectiveness across thermal cycling and vibration, and validate these choices through application-specific testing.

Fourth, elevate documentation and change control as strategic assets. Establish clear requirements for certificates, material declarations, and test reports, and insist on advance notification of formulation or process changes. This improves audit readiness and protects product platforms from unplanned requalification.

Finally, integrate installation training and field feedback loops. Many shield-related failures originate at termination or routing, not in the cable itself. By capturing installer pain points, updating work instructions, and collaborating with suppliers on practical tooling and termination guidance, organizations can improve first-pass yields and reduce downtime risk.
